What Types of Jobs Can a 14-Year-Old Get in the Restaurant Industry in Lafayette, LA?

At 14, you’ll generally work in entry-level restaurant positions designed to build skills in customer service and teamwork.

Common jobs include host/hostess greeting and seating guests, busser clearing tables, dishwasher cleaning kitchenware, cashier handling payments, and food prep assistant helping with basic meal preparation. You can learn more about the busser job description for insight into this role.

Wages typically start at the federal minimum wage of $7.25 per hour, but some employers may pay more based on duties and experience.

Fast-Food Places That Hire at 14 in Lafayette, LA

McDonald’s

McDonald’s employs crew members aged 14 for customer service and food prep tasks, offering valuable experience in a fast-paced environment.

Chick-fil-A

Chick-fil-A hires team members who engage customers and assist in kitchen duties, suitable for motivated teens.

Burger King

At Burger King, 14-year-olds can work as cashiers and food prep assistants, learning order accuracy and kitchen prep.

Wendy’s

Wendy’s offers positions in customer service and kitchen help, supporting team-oriented teens. Understanding hostess job descriptions can also help employers when outlining customer-facing roles.

KFC

KFC employs young team members to help with food service and maintenance tasks, gaining practical restaurant knowledge.

Subway

Subway’s sandwich artist roles involve food prep and serving customers, ideal for teens interested in fresh-food settings.

Dairy Queen

How Many Hours Can a 14-Year-Old Work in Lafayette, LA?

Louisiana child labor laws restrict work hours for 14-year-olds to safeguard education and wellbeing.

When school is in session, teens may work no more than 3 hours per school day and 18 hours per school week.

Permissible work hours during school days are from 7 a.m. to 7 p.m.

When school is not in session, limits increase to 8 hours per day and 40 hours per week.

During summer (June 1 through Labor Day), work hours extended until 9 p.m. are allowed.

All minors must receive a 30-minute meal break after working 5 consecutive hours.
